About Bramble
Sweet Bramble is hoping to find a gentle, patient home to settle into. About 2 years old, she loves affection and warms up nicely once she feels safe, though she can be shy and a bit nervous in noisy environments. A quieter household without dogs suits her best, especially if children are older and familiar with cats. Bramble’s short black coat and adorable nub tail make her hard to resist—she’s got a soft spot for chin scratches and comfy beds by the window. Treats and a little time go a long way with her; she opens up to become a loving companion at her own pace. Bramble is spayed, microchipped, vaccinated, and ready for a new beginning.
